ConfusedUs posted:

Huh I wonder how Ruthlessness works with Tractor Beams.

Does it proc off the original or new position of the target?

Ruthlessness is after the attack, whereas the Tractor Token and associated boost/br is part of the attack, so I'd go afterwards personall. COuld be good, could be bad.

Also worth noting that the boost/br is not optional. You have to take it (presumably, unless it's blocked by enemy ships).

Also, this puts paid to some extent to my thoughts of illicits that say 'take a tractor token and then'.

Although, voluntarily taking a tractor token to get a no-action not-boost/not-br would be an interesting mechanic.

The tractor beam card says "if this attack hits, the defender recieves one tractor beam token. Then cancel all dice results."

The tractor beam token card reads "the first time a small ship recieves a tractor beam token each round"

Ruthlessness triggers "after you perform an attack that hits" (emphasis mine).

My interpretation would be that the defender recieving the tractor beam token is part of the initial attack, which is interrupted halfway through before you cancel dice results to trigger the barrel roll or boost. Once everything has resolved you would then trigger Ruthlessness.

A BIG loving BLUNT posted:

Just got the core set after playing a demo of this and had fun. Whats the most economical way to expand my collection? Should I buy another core set to expand? I'm too poor to just buy all the X-Wangs so I need to budget myself. What's good for 100 point tournaments?

My usual advice is that you can't go wrong with the other core set, imperial aces and rebel aces - but really, your best option is to find a local club and borrow some ships, find out what you enjoy playing, and work from there.

Use https://geordanr.github.io/xwing/ to build lists - and most local clubs will be fine with you using printouts from there in casual games as long as you have the mini, the dial, and the base token from somewhere.

Then use http://randolphw.github.io/han-shopped-first/ to figure out the most economical way to buy it.
